Governor Yahaya Flags Off Wet Season Farming Support

Gombe State Governor Muhammadu Inuwa Yahaya has flagged off the distribution of subsidized fertiliser to farmers as part of the state’s support for the 2025 wet season farming.

At the event on Thursday, Governor Yahaya said the initiative is intended to boost crop production and make fertiliser more accessible to farmers across the state.

“The government has procured 10,000 tons of NPK 20:10:10 fertiliser at the cost of N44,000 per bag but will sell it to farmers at N27,000 per bag to ease their financial burden,” he said.

To ensure transparency, the governor directed the State Ministry of Agriculture, Animal Husbandry and Cooperatives to work closely with security agencies to monitor the sales and distribution.

He stressed the importance of reaching the actual farmers, particularly those in rural communities.

Governor Yahaya also cautioned both farmers and herders to avoid activities that could trigger conflicts. “Farmers should stay away from grazing reserves and cattle routes, while herders must avoid farmlands until after harvest,” he said.

Commissioner for Agriculture, Animal Husbandry and Cooperatives, Dr. Barnabas Malle, appealed to local government chairmen and community leaders to cooperate with ministry officials during the fertiliser distribution process.

Meanwhile, the State Coordinator of the Federal Ministry of Agriculture and Food Security, Mr. Absalom Akwaras Lansibol, praised the state’s effort, saying: “We commend the Gombe State government for providing timely and affordable farm inputs to farmers.”
